Kintpuash or Kientpaush or also known as Captain Jack (1837-1873).    He was a Modoc Indian Chief   He led a group away from the Klamath Reservation  and tried to return to their lands in California.     He was later to be charged with War crimes when he entered a peace talk with a concealed weapon and MURDERED General Edward Canby.    He was captured, tried and found guilty at the time of this photograph and hung by the Army on October 3, 1873.   This image was taken by  L. Heller and produced by Watkins' Yosemite Art Gallery.    It is a pristine image.
